Notes from the Minthollow payments review: rounding in the FX converter was applying banker's rounding before the spread, producing one-cent drift on certain lira pairs. Fix is to round once, after spread application, using half-up at the target currency's precision. A reconciliation job now flags drift daily. Escalations during on-call should go directly to the owner named below.

named custodian: Brivan Eliath Quenox Frador

Onboarding: Monthly partitioning — Querrel Analytics

For the weekly eng sync: the events table in Brackenlake is partitioned by calendar month, and the partition-maintenance job creates next month's partition on the 25th. Never drop a partition manually; use the retention script, which verifies archives first. Backfills must target the correct monthly partition explicitly. Access to the retention controls requires unsealing the admin store with the recovery passphrase below.

unlock words, kagef-taduf: fenir-quenix-norwyn-sorvan-gormir-gorir-fraok

### Step 6: Template Cache Warmup

Plugin templates render cold on first request. Run `hollyfort warm --plugins` post-deploy to precompile; skipping this adds ~900ms latency per page until caches fill. Budget: 50ms warm render max. Plugins exceeding budget get throttled by the Hollyfort gateway. Submissions must be signed before upload; sign your plugin bundle with the key below.

release key, fahaf-bajof: bky3_Xam

## Environments — RenderMill Transcoding Farm

RenderMill runs three environments: sandbox (single node, synthetic media only), staging (mirrors production codecs and the Fenwick storage tier), and production (autoscaled workers in two regions). Release manager responsibilities: promote builds sandbox → staging → production, and confirm the staging soak runs at least 24 hours of mixed 4K and HDR jobs. Each environment reads its settings from a mounted config bundle at boot. The production bundle currently contains the values below.

deployment values, yadug-bawif:
[framir]
team = pelox
access_code = ac_a38ab2
owner = tamion.julael
host = framir.tolvaqlabs.test
port = 11211
peer = tammir.zemvargrid.local
salt = 2215ef03
pin = 1541